Машинный язык

Определение "Машинный язык" в Большой Советской Энциклопедии


Машинный язык, язык программирования, содержание и правила которого реализованы аппаратными средствами ЦВМ. Машинный язык состоит из системы команд ЦВМ и метода кодирования информации (исходных данных, результатов вычислений), принятого в ЦВМ. Символами Машинный язык являются двоичные цифры; как правило, символы группируются в конструкции (морфемы) - адреса в командах, коды операций и признаки команд; из команд составляются программы, реализующие алгоритмы задач. Эффективность решения различных задач на ЦВМ в значительной степени зависит от того, насколько Машинный язык приспособлен для реализации заданных алгоритмов. В программе, составленной на Машинный язык, или, как иногда говорят, в машинном коде, должны быть заданы вполне определённые команды для выполнения каждой операции. При этом точно указывается, где должны храниться числа (ячейка запоминающего устройства), как пересылать и обрабатывать числа и где хранить результаты вычислений.


Программирование на Машинный язык ведётся в системе команд ЦВМ, поэтому Машинный язык рекомендуется использовать для создания программ (операционные системы, трансляторы алгоритмических языков, библиотеки стандартных программ), расширяющих логические возможности ЦВМ, и для создания программ, на которые наложены ограничения по времени выполнения и объёму памяти ЦВМ. Недостатки программирования на Машинный язык: программы, написанные для ЦВМ одного типа, не пригодны для ЦВМ другого типа; продолжительные сроки обучения программистов; программист, научившийся программировать на одной машине, должен фактически переучиваться при переходе к программированию на другой машине. Один из путей развития Машинный язык - приближение Машинный язык к языкам высшего уровня (тем самым упрощаются трансляторы с алгоритмических языков).
  Л. В. Гусев.





"БСЭ" >> "М" >> "МА" >> "МАШ"

Статья про "Машинный язык" в Большой Советской Энциклопедии была прочитана 525 раз
Пицца в сковороде
Кетчуп из бананов

TOP 20